Pontus Leitzler b1c90890d2 internal/lsp/source: do not panic in "var func" outgoing callhierarchy
When trying to get outgoing call hierarchy from an var func like:

func main() {
    foo := func() {}
    foo()
}

gopls crashed with a panic.

This change makes it return an empty call hierarchy instead.
It also adds support for testing outgoing calls where the expected
result is 0 items, to be able to test this change.

Muir Manders 7bb39e4ca9 internal/lsp/source: fix default param name generation
When generating a default param name based on a type name, we want to
ignore any package qualifier. For example, if the type is "ast.Node"
we want to generate the variable name "n", so we must ignore the
"ast." qualifier. To do this we use a types.Qualifier that always
returns empty, but qualifyExpr wasn't respecting an empty qualifier
because it is doing manual ast manipulation. However, it seems like
things "just work" if you set a SelectorExpr's "X" to empty
string (i.e. only "Sel" is output when formatting).

Rob Findley 6d2eea5430 internal/typesinternal: use Go 1.16 metadata for go/types errors
In Go 1.16 error codes as well as start and end positions are added for
go/types errors. This information is temporarily stored in unexported
fields, until we're more confident in the correctness of both the API
and the underlying data.

Read this information using reflection and, if available, use it to set
the corresponding field in compiler diagnostics. This establishes a
positive feedback loop: in most cases this should improve the gopls
diagnostic, and wherever it doesn't we can make a note and fall back on
the old heuristics for that error code.

Muir Manders ca1c149215 internal/lsp: offer type converted completion candidates
For example:

    func wantsInt64(int64)            {}
    func wantsDuration(time.Duration) {}

    func _() {
      for i := range []string{} {
        // inserts "i" as "int64(i)"
        wantsInt64(i<>)

        // inserts "i" as "time.Duration(i)"
        wantsDuration(i<>)
      }
    }

Type converted candidates have a significant score penalty so they
should never outrank a directly assignable candidate, other factors
being equal.

To minimize false positive completions, we don't offer converted
candidates if either:
- The candidate is a deep completion into another package. This avoids
  random "float64(somepkg.SomeVar)" popping up when completing a
  float64.
- Don't offer to convert ints to strings since that's not normally
  what the user wants.

After going back and forth I decided not to include the type
conversion in the candidate label. This means you will just see the
candidate "i" in the completion popup instead of "float64(i)". Type
names add a lot of noise to the candidate list.

I also tweaked the untyped constant penalty to interplay better with
the new type conversion penalty. I wanted untyped constants to be
ranked above type conversion candidates since they are directly
assignable, so I reduced untyped constants' penalty. However, to
continue suppressing untyped constants from random other packages, I
applied a similar heuristic to above where we give a bigger penalty if
the untyped constant is a deep completion from another package.

Muir Manders 5bad45943a internal/lsp: fix godef for embedded type aliases
In

    type myAlias = someType
    type _ struct {
      myAlias
    }

Previously running "definition" on the "myAlias" field would take you
to the definition of "someType" instead of "myAlias". This is because
we were using the field's (*types.Var).Type() which has already
forgotten it is an alias. Fix by instead looking up the field name
ident in types.Info.Uses which yields the *types.TypeName (for the
type alias).

Robert Findley 88346e9948 internal/lsp: refactor workspace Symbol method
This is based on Paul Jolly's CL 228760, updated to use the new cache
API, support the symbolStyle configuration option, and lift up the
concept of symbol score for later improvement.

From that CL:

There are a number of issues with the current implementation:

* test variant packages are not handled correctly, meaning duplicate
  symbols are returned
* fuzzy results are not ordered by score

We refactor the implementation of workspace symbol to use a
symbolCollector that carries context during the walk for symbols. As
part of resolving the test variant issue, we first determine a list of
packages to walk.

(*symbolCollector).collectPackages gathers the packages we are going to
inspect for symbols. This pre-step is required in order to filter out
any "duplicate" *types.Package. The duplicates arise for packages that
have test variants.  For example, if package mod.com/p has test files,
then we will visit two packages that have the PkgPath() mod.com/p: the
first is the actual package mod.com/p, the second is a special version
that includes the non-XTest _test.go files. If we were to walk both of
of these packages, then we would get duplicate matching symbols and we
would waste effort. Therefore where test variants exist we walk those
(because they include any symbols defined in non-XTest _test.go files).

One further complication is that even after this filtering, packages
between views might not be "identical" because they can be built using
different build constraints (via the "env" config option). Therefore on
a per view basis we first build up a map of PkgPath() -> *types.Package
preferring the test variants if they exist. Then we merge the results
between views, de-duping by *types.Package.

Finally, when we come to walk these packages and start gathering
symbols, we ignore any files we have already seen (due to different
*types.Package for the same import path as a result of different build
constraints), keeping track of those symbols via symbolCollector.

Then we walk that list of packages in much the same way as before.

Muir Manders 74543c4034 internal/lsp/source: fix composite literal type name completion
Fix completion in the following cases:

    type foo struct{}

    // now we offer "&foo" instead of "foo"
    var _ *foo = fo<>{}

    struct { f *foo }{
      // now we offer "&foo" instead of "*foo"
      f: fo<>{},
    }

Composite literal type names are a bit special because they are part
of an arbitrary value expression rather than just a standalone type
name expression. In particular, they can be preceded by "&", which
affects how they relate to the surrounding context. The "&" doesn't
technically apply to the type name, but we must take it into account.

I made three changes to fix the behavior:
1. When we want to make a composite literal type name into a pointer,
   we use "&" instead of "*".
2. Record if a composite literal type is already has a "&" so we don't
   add it again.
3. Fix "var _ *foo = fo<>{}" to properly infer expected type of "*foo"
   by not stopping at *ast.CompositeLit searching up AST path when the
   position is in the type name (as opposed to within the curlies).

Muir Manders 9ac8e33b36 internal/lsp/source: improve completion of printf operands
We now rank printf operand candidates according to the corresponding
formatting verb. We follow what fmt allows for the most part, but I
omitted some things because they are uncommon and would result in many
false positives, or didn't seem worth it to support:

- We don't prefer fmt.Stringer or error types for "%x" or "%X".
- We don't prefer pointers for any verbs except "%p".
- We don't prefer recursive application of verbs (e.g. we won't prefer
  []string for "%s").

I decided against sharing code with the printf analyzer. It was
tangled somewhat with go/analysis, and I needed only a very small
subset of the format parsing.

I tweaked candidate type evaluation to accommodate the printf hints.
We now skip expected type of "interface{}" when matching candidate
types because it matches everything and would always supersede the
coarser object kind checks.

Muir Manders 90abf76919 internal/lsp/source: fix a couple issues completing append() args
In this example:

     p := &[]int{}
     append([]int{}, *<>)

At <> we completed to "**p" instead of "*p...". There were two fixes:

1. builtinArgType() wasn't propagating the "modifiers", so we were
   forgetting about the preceding "*" pointer indirection and
   inserting it again with the completion. Fix by propagating
   modifiers.
2. The candidate formatting responsible for adding "..." had over
   simplified logic to determine if we are completing the variadic
   param. Now instead the candidate evaluation code marks the
   candidate as "variadic" so the formatting doesn't have to think at
   all.

Muir Manders 7c0525f229 internal/lsp/source: improve func literal completions
When a signature doesn't name its params, we make up param
names when generating a corresponding func literal:

    var f func(myType) // no param name
    f = fun<> // completes to "func(mt myType) {}"

Previously we would abbreviate named types and fall back to "_" for
builtins or repeated names. We would require placeholders to be
enabled when using "_" so the user could name the param easily. That
left users that don't use placeholders with no completion at all in
this case.

I made the following improvements:
- Generate a name for all params. For builtin types we use the first
  letter, e.g. "i" for "int", "s" for "[]string". If a name is
  repeated, we append incrementing numeric suffixes. For example,
  "func(int, int32)" becomes "func(i1 int, i2 int32").
- No longer require placeholders to be enabled in any case.
- Fix handling of alias types so the param name and type name are
  based on the alias, not the aliasee.

I also tweaked formatVarType to qualify packages using a
types.Qualifier. I needed it to respect a qualifier that doesn't
qualify anything so I could format e.g. "http.Response" as just
"Response" to come up with param names.

Josh Baum 74a6bbb346 internal/lsp: enhance fillstruct and fillreturns to fill with variables
In the previous implementation, we always created a default
value for each type in the struct or return statement in fillstruct
and fillreturns, respectively. Now, we try to find a variable in scope
that matches the expected type. If we find multiple matches, we choose
the variable that is named most similarly to the type. If we do not
find a variable that matches, we maintain the previous functionality.

Muir Manders 6f4f008689 internal/lsp/source: improve completion in switch cases
Now we downrank candidates that have already been used in other switch
cases. For example:

    switch time.Now().Weekday() {
    case time.Monday:
    case time.<> // downrank time.Monday
    }

It wasn't quite as simple as tracking the seen types.Objects.
Consider this example:

    type foo struct {
      i int
    }

    var a, b foo

    switch 123 {
    case a.i:
    case <>
    }

At <> we don't want to downrank "b.i" even though "i" is represented
as the same types.Object for "a.i" and "b.i". To accommodate this, we
track having seen ["a", "i"] together. We will downrank "a.i", but not
"b.i".

I applied only a minor 0.9 downranking when the candidate has already
been used in another case clause. It is hard to know what the user is
planning. For instance, in the preceding example the user could intend
to write "a.i + 1", so we mustn't downrank "a.i" too much.

Muir Manders 19738be007 internal/lsp/source: improve type switch case completion
Now we will filter out the types already used in other case
statements:

    switch ast.Node(nil).(type) {
    case *ast.Ident:
    case *ast.I<> // don't offer "Ident" since it has been used
    }

Note that the implementation was not able to use a map to track the
seen types.Types because we build up types.Type entries dynamically
when searching for completions (e.g. types.NewPointer() to make a
pointer type). We must use types.Identical() instead of direct pointer
equality.
